(d) A general casualty company may change the company's | ||
securities on deposit with the comptroller by withdrawing those | ||
securities and substituting an equal amount of other securities | ||
consisting only of: | ||
(1) United States currency; | ||
(2) bonds of any state; | ||
(3) bonds or other evidences of indebtedness of the | ||
United States the principal and interest of which are guaranteed by | ||
the United States; | ||
(4) bonds or other interest-bearing evidences of | ||
indebtedness of a county or municipality of any state; | ||
(5) notes secured by first mortgages: | ||
(A) on otherwise unencumbered real property in | ||
this state the title to which is valid; and | ||
(B) the payment of which is insured wholly or | ||
partly by the United States; or | ||
(6) another form of security acceptable to the | ||

SECTION 2. Subsection (a), Section 861.252, and Section | ||
982.306, Insurance Code, are repealed. | ||
SECTION 3. This Act takes effect immediately if it receives | ||
a vote of two-thirds of all the members elected to each house, as | ||
provided by Section 39, Article III, Texas Constitution. If this | ||
Act does not receive the vote necessary for immediate effect, this | ||
Act takes effect September 1, 2013. | ||
